This upcoming Friday (May 7) Pigeon Forge will host the 25th Annual Dolly Parade, the unofficial start of this year’s tourist season and the 25th Anniversary season of Dollywood. Legendary local singer and songwriter Dolly Parton will be the parade’s grand marshal. The parkway will be lined with parade watchers admiring floats, marching bands, celebrities and of course the areas favorite daughter, Dolly. This year’s parade will begin at 6PM.
In addition to the Dolly Parade this weekend, Saturday morning at 9AM the Shrines will hold their Fun Fest Parade in downtown Pigeon Forge.

Dollywood’s newest attraction, Adventure Mountain, is scheduled to be completed for the park’s opening on March 27. Due to the economy the attraction was delayed until this year.
Adventure Mountain is billed as the largest challenge course in the country. There are four separate courses with 46 different elements plus a children’s area. The themed attraction will have much of the look and feel of the Great Smoky Mountains National Park in its early years.
Dollywood theme park recently claimed its 4th consecutive Heartbeat Award at the International Assoc. of Amusement Parks & Attractions Expo held in Las Vegas.
This year’s award was for “Sha-Kon-O-Hey! Land of the Blue Smoke”, featuring eight songs written by Dolly Parton. The parks previous Heartbeat Award winners were “Dreamland Drive In” in 2006 & 2008 and “The Great American Country Show” in 2007.

Dollywood has announced that it will not be holding its annual Barbeque & Bluegrass Festival this fall. Park officials stated the festival, originally scheduled to take place Sept. 4-21, 2009, is on hiatus.

Dollywood announced this week it will begin construction on a new attraction for 2010, Adventure Mountain. Originally scheduled to open this year the project was delayed due to a road construction project and the poor economy.
The new attraction, to be located on a hill above the Tennessee Tornado rollercoaster, will cover 2 acres. The attraction will offer visitors some of the challenges of the outdoors with three different courses rated from easy to expert to test the skill and strength levels of participants.
